Plasma Metabonomic Analysis Of Neoplasm Patients With Abnormal Savda Syndrome Based On High Performance Liquid Chromatography (HPLC) And Gas Chromatography (GC)

Objective: Uighur medicine based on the technique of high performanceliquid chromatography (HPLC) and gas chromatography (GC) to analysis thechanges of the amino acid and fatty acid content in abnormal Savda tumorsyndromes patients,which can analysis the mechanism of differencemetabolites.Methods: plasma samples from225cases of abnormal Savdatumor syndromes patients,232cases of abnormal unsavda syndromeneoplasm patients and50cases of healthy people. Samples were detectedwith HPLC and GC after special preparation. The data were compiled andintegrated, than identify the discrepant metabolin of the amino acid and fattyacid content by Orthogonal Partial Least-Squares Discriminant Analysis(OPLS-DA)and T text.Results: OPLS-DA analysis of spatial distribution ofabnormal Savda showed obvious trends in the classification of cancer patientsand healthy people. Compared with healthy people: include isoleucine,leucine, alanine, histidine, glutamic etc.in plasma samples. They arestatistically significant difference (P<0.05)in quantification results.Inaddition, saturated fatty acid include Myristic acid, palmitic acid, palm oil,acid, stearic acid, EPA, arachidic acid content has statistically significantdifference (P<0.05) in plasma.Compared to abnormal Savda syndrome tumorpatients, abnormal Unsavda syndrome tumor patients have statisticalsignificance in valinein leucine, isoleucine, glutamic, serine in plasmasamples, Besides peanut acid have difference was statistically significant difference (P<0.05) in plasma samples Conclusion:(1) Based on the dataanaylsis and identify the discrepant metabolin in plasma samples neoplasmpatients with abnormal Savda (2)Abnormal Savda patients, whose the citricacid cycle and glycolytic pathway of tumor patients is suppressed, amino acidmetabolism, branched-chain amino acid metabolism enhancement; higherlevels of saturated fatty acids...
